What is a Crabapple (Malus)?
Malus is a genus of approximately 35 species of small deciduous trees and shrubs in the family Rosaceae. The genus is native to the temperate regions of the Northern Hemisphere, with the majority of species being distributed in Asia, North America, and Europe. The crabapple is particularly renowned for its attractive blossoms, colorful fruit, and often striking autumn foliage.
Crabapple trees are appreciated for their versatility in the landscape, offering aesthetic value as well as providing food and habitat for wildlife. With a wide range of sizes, shapes, and flowering and fruiting characteristics, crabapples have become a popular choice in gardens, parks, and urban spaces.

Water
Proper watering is crucial for the health and vitality of Malus trees, particularly during their establishment phase and in periods of drought.
Establishment Phase:
– Newly planted crabapples require regular watering to assist in the development of their root systems and promote establishment in their new environment.
– It is important to provide consistent moisture without waterlogging the soil.
Drought Conditions:
– During dry spells, supplemental watering is advisable to maintain adequate soil moisture and support the tree’s physiological functions.
– Water deeply and ensure the root zone is sufficiently hydrated to prevent stress and dehydration.
Sunlight
The sunlight requirements of crabapple trees are integral to their overall growth, flowering, and fruiting potential.
Full Sun:
– Malus trees thrive in full sun, which typically equates to at least 6 hours of direct sunlight per day.
– Adequate sunlight exposure promotes healthy foliage, robust flowering, and the development of high-quality fruit.
Partial Shade:
– While crabapples prefer full sun, they can tolerate partial shade. However, reduced sunlight may impact their flowering, fruiting, and overall vigor.
Fertilizer
Fertilization plays a pivotal role in sustaining the nutrient levels required for prolific flowering, fruiting, and overall plant health.
Nutrient Requirements:
– Crabapple trees benefit from a balanced fertilizer that supplies essential macronutrients such as nitrogen, phosphorus, and potassium, as well as micronutrients including iron, manganese, and zinc.
Application Timing:
– Fertilize crabapples in early spring as they begin their active growth phase. Avoid late-season fertilization to prevent encouraging tender new growth that can be vulnerable to frost damage.
Soil
A suitable soil environment is essential to ensure the well-being and longevity of Malus trees.
Well-Drained Soil:
– Crabapples prefer well-drained soil that prevents waterlogging and the potential for root suffocation.
– Aeration of the soil allows for the exchange of gases, fostering healthy root development and microbial activity.
Soil pH:
– The optimal soil pH range for crabapple trees is typically between 5.5 and 6.5. A slightly acidic to neutral pH promotes nutrient availability and uptake.
Pruning
Pruning is an important aspect of crabapple tree care, serving various purposes including shaping, structural enhancement, and fruit production.
Timing:
– Pruning is best carried out during the dormant season in late winter or early spring, before new growth emerges.
– Summer pruning can be employed for corrective shaping, but major pruning is generally reserved for the dormant period.
Objectives:
– Prune to remove dead, damaged, or diseased wood and to enhance air circulation within the canopy.
– Thinning cuts may be utilized to reduce canopy density, promoting light infiltration and minimizing disease pressure.
Propagation
The propagation of Malus trees can be achieved through several methods, each with distinct advantages and challenges.
Seed Propagation:
– Sowing seeds is a viable propagation method to produce crabapple trees, particularly for developing new cultivars and species.
– Seed propagation can yield a wide range of genetic variability, resulting in unique characteristics in the offspring.
Vegetative Propagation:
– Grafting and budding are common methods of vegetative propagation utilized for preserving specific traits and characteristics of selected crabapple varieties.
– These techniques enable the consistent replication of desired attributes in the propagated plants.

Container Common Diseases
When growing crabapples in containers, it is essential to be aware of potential diseases that may affect the trees.
Root Rot:
– Poor drainage in containers can lead to waterlogged soil, predisposing crabapples to root rot diseases caused by various fungi.
– Healthy root systems are vital for container-grown trees to withstand environmental stressors and disease pressure.
Anthracnose:
– Anthracnose fungi can infect crabapple foliage, causing leaf spots and defoliation. The disease can be exacerbated by moist conditions and poor air circulation within containers

Common Pests
Several insect pests can pose a threat to crabapple trees, potentially impacting their growth and aesthetic appeal.
Aphids:
– Aphids are common sap-feeding insects that can colonize and damage tender new growth, causing leaf curling, distortion, and the development of sticky honeydew.
– Natural predators such as ladybird beetles and lacewings can assist in controlling aphid populations.
Caterpillars:
– Various caterpillar species, including the tent caterpillar and the fall webworm, can defoliate crabapple trees if populations go unchecked.
– Bacillus thuringiensis (Bt) and other biological insecticides are effective options for managing caterpillar infestations.

Fun Facts
Before concluding our exploration of crabapples, let’s uncover some fascinating and delightful facts about these charming trees.
- The wood of crabapple trees is valued for its hardness and is utilized in the crafting of tool handles and small wooden objects.
- Crabapples are closely related to domesticated apple trees (Malus domestica) and can potentially hybridize with them, contributing to the genetic diversity of cultivated apple varieties.
- In various cultures and folklore, crabapples have been associated with symbolism representing love, fertility, and protection.
